The Sensory Animals of Ston Hill
Chapter 30 The Wind and the Sea Are Greatly Calm
"Sir..." Grace tremblingly opened the bandage wrapped around Mr. Welsh's arm, "Your wound is pus..." His face was paler than that of Mr. Welsh who had lost a lot of blood, because of the cold, his eyes He couldn't even secrete tears, but with wet eyes in his eyes, he asked with trembling lips, "Sir, what should I do? How can I help you?"
When the servants rushed into Butler Ward's room, what they saw was a maid in torn nightgown, frightened and speechless, and two men lying in a pool of blood.
It is said that in order to protect the reputation of the maid Grace, Mr. Welsh fought with the housekeeper Ward. Mr. Ward died on the spot, and Mr. Welsh was seriously injured in the arm.
There were three male servants and one female servant who witnessed the incident, and then Mrs. Brown hurried over, and the room was sealed off, so including the Countess and the two surviving persons involved, there were a total of Eight insiders.
Mrs. Brown said that the countess was afraid of the blood, and ordered the three servants to carry the weak Mr. Welsh into a bungalow far away from the castle at night, and she herself and the maid supported Grace, and forced him into the palace. in the same room.
"Mr. Wales said he was injured to protect you, so you will take care of him." Mrs. Brown said to Grace coldly.After she walked out of the room, Grace raised Mr. Wales' injured arm and heard the sound of a lock being locked outside.
Like when he and Sophie and Orisa had typhoid, they were locked up.
Grace rushed to the door and tugged at the handle, and sure enough, the door was locked.
No one to help, no medicine, no bedding and charcoal fire.This was a temporary dwelling built for the Italian stonemasons, and the castle was repaired, and the dwelling fell into disrepair when the Italians returned to their country.After a winter of idleness, the room here has become extremely gloomy and cold, and the cold wind in the late night of early spring came in through the window cracks.
Grace tore her skirt into strips and bandaged the wound under the guidance of Mr. Wales.Due to the massive blood loss, Mr. Welsh was cold and shivering on the hard bed.
Grace slammed on the door and shouted: "I need water! And bedding! I need medicine!"
The door was pushed open immediately, and two of the three male servants who witnessed the incident were outside the door, one of them covered Grace's mouth in horror, and the other said regretfully and helplessly: "Grace, Mrs. Brown It's already been prepared."
Under their restraint, Grace shook her head helplessly, tears streaming down the back of the man's hand.
He grabbed the manservant's wrist, making a gesture to kneel down to him.The servant was also in love with Grace, and he hugged his sweetheart's thin back sadly, as if he wanted to hug her into his arms, "Grace, he killed someone... He killed Mr. Butler! If you don't want to be implicated, Just don't disobey Madam..."
Grace beat his arm in grief and anger, and the footman let go of him, unbearable in pain.
"Grace..." Mr. Wales called weakly.
Grace rushed to the bed immediately, and the door closed quietly behind him again.
Grace took Mr. Welsh's injured arm, the blood was still flowing, and completely soaked the white cloth strips he tore off from his nightgown into red: "Sir, I will yell right now, my voice is very loud, I will put the whole house in the mountain Wake everyone up, call the Sheriff over here, and let people know what they're doing!"
Mr. Welsh's weak eyes showed relief, "Miss Grace, you are really sharp..."
Grace cried bitterly on the edge of the bed, "Mr. Wales, I killed you!"
"No, Miss Grace, it's not your fault. It is my responsibility to protect you. This is the task entrusted to me by adults. It is my honor to do this for you."
"My lord, my lord...why did he..."
Mr. Wales smiled gently, "Miss Grace, don't cry..." and then passed out
During the following day, Mr. Wales fell asleep and woke up.The three male servants and the maid who were involved were all familiar with Grace, and they were persuaded by Grace to secretly give him some water and bread.Grace soaked the bread in water until soft, and fed it to Mr. Wales bit by bit when he became conscious.
But the doctor never came.
"Ms. Brown said... that someone has been sent to ask for it." The maid was only two years older than Grace. She was frightened by this incident, and she had countless questions in her heart. She didn't understand why the person died suddenly, and why she died No one would go to the police, she didn't understand why Grace and Mr. Welsh were locked up, she didn't understand why the doctor couldn't come for a long time... But she didn't dare to ask, so she could only repeat this sentence to Grace, talking cry.
Without a doctor, there is no medicine.On the second night, Mr. Wales developed a high fever and soon fell into a coma.
Grace knelt and prayed in front of the window, which was crucified from the outside, and the moonlight shone in through the gaps in the planks, falling into Grace's desperate eyes.
"Father, please forgive my sins! Forgive me for disrespecting you in the past! If I can get out from here, I will pray every day, make offerings sincerely, and promise to memorize the entire Bible! I promise that every Sunday in the future They all go to church, and the priest never sleeps when he talks, nor laughs at him in his heart... Father, I was wrong! It was my fault alone, please help this good man!"
Mr. Wales uttered a raving in a coma: "Cold...cold...my lord..." The last words he said to Grace before he passed out completely were: "Miss Grace, to be offensive, I once had a daughter , if she is still alive, she will be your age."
Grace rushed to the side of the bed and touched his forehead, which became even hotter, and the wet cotton cloth that had been covering the hot forehead was also hot.
Is it because he is an illegitimate child?Because he pretended to be a girl to survive, so he was born more sinful than ordinary people?Otherwise why punish him like this?Let him witness such helpless death again and again, let him feel his father's love for the first time, and take it away immediately.
Grace tapped on the door gently with a towel in her hand. He didn't dare to be presumptuous anymore, for fear of offending anyone. He knocked on the door and cried in a low voice: "Please, give me some more water, he's going to die, give me some more water." Get some water!"
There was no sound outside the door.Grace collapsed to the ground, pressing a wet cloth to her tearful eyes, "Father, please tell me what I should do! Who can save him!"
"My lord! You can't—" There was a panicked cry from outside the door, the voice of the footman.
"Which room?" A deep and calm voice came from a distance, caught in the chaotic footsteps.
Grace slammed her fists on the door with a loud "bang!", and he hissed and shouted: "My lord! We are here!" Help us!
Jesus said, "You people of little faith, why are you so timid?" Then he got up and rebuked the wind and the sea, and they were greatly calmed.
----
Note:
Jesus said, "You people of little faith, why are you so timid?" Then he got up and rebuked the wind and the sea, and they were greatly calmed. —Matthew 8:26
It is about that Jesus and his disciples were in a boat, when a storm suddenly broke out, and the sea water was about to fill the cabin. The disciples were terrified, but Jesus woke up and rebuked the wind and rain, and the sea returned to calm.
